Detective Nalley

Detective Lauren Nalley of the Athens-Clarke County Police Department has been named The Cottage’s 2024 Child Advocate of the Year for her dedication to supporting children and families affected by trauma.

According to The Cottage Sexual Assault Center and Children’s Advocacy Center, “Detective Nalley embodies extraordinary dedication in supporting children and families through trauma-informed investigations. Her tireless work behind the scenes ensures families receive crucial resources for healing.”

Detective Nalley emphasized the importance of her work, stating, “I believe the work that we do at the Family Protection Center is vital because we provide a unique approach to crimes of a sensitive nature to better serve members of our community.”

The Cottage serves Clarke County, providing crisis support and resources to survivors of sexual assault and child abuse. The organization operates a 24/7 crisis hotline and offers educational programs, intervention services, and public awareness efforts within schools, churches, and other community agencies.
